Test Description

The numbers below refer to the step numbers on the diagnostic table. See Fig 1 and Fig 2 .

  1. 2

    Tests for the proper operation of the circuit in the low voltage range.
  2. 3

    Tests for the proper operation of the circuit in the high voltage range. If the fuse in the jumper opens when you perform this test, the signal circuit is shorted to ground.
  3. 4

    Tests for a short to voltage in the 5 volt reference circuit.
